Brett McLamb (Triton, Campbell) had a 71.67 scoring average for 12 rounds as a graduate transfer for the N.C. State golf team before the season was canceled due to efforts to prevent the spread of the coronavirus. McLamb’s average ranked third for the Wolfpack. … Former Louisville left offensive tackle Mekhi Becton reportedly had a drug test flagged at the NFL combine. Becton will enter Stage 1 of the league’s intervention program. He will be tested periodically for 60 days. Becton is a projected top 10 pick in the NFL draft, which starts Thursday. … Southern Cal quarterback J.T. Daniels has entered the transfer portal. … Memphis guard Tyler Harris plans to transfer after averaging 9.8 points in two seasons with the Tigers. … Virginia Tech transfer guard Landers Nolley II will announce his commitment today. His final three include Georgia, Memphis and Ole Miss. He averaged 15.5 points and 5.8 rebounds as a freshman in 2019-20.
